When is the best time to plant a willow bush?

The best time to plant a willow bush is in the late winter or the early spring. This is when the willow, which is a deciduous bush, is dormant. Also, this is the time that ground that has been frozen during the mid-winter begins to thaw.

Planting the bush during the summer is inadvisable because it's too hot, and the stress of the heat and the stress of being transplanted may overwhelm the bush. If planting in late winter or early spring isn't an option, the bush can be planted during the fall; however, the bush must then undergo the rigors of the coming winter.
